I binged prison shows a few years back. I recall that in many prisons, people will make noise kicking their doors, screaming and so on all night. It's not lights out and everyone has a quiet 8hr sleep. In shu units people are segregated and lots of things are individual, and it's also where the worst people go(not just ethics but lost the plot kinda stuff). People can be a menace in there and there isn't much anyone can do about it, other prisoners or staff, they're already in the worst place and other inmates can't get to them.
They run a strict schedule yes, showers at a certain time and rec 2 or 3 times a week, but none of that is delayed if someone is acting a fool. It's standard operating procedure. Also meals are brought to the cell and given through the trap in the door, so you can be dead asleep but when that trap opens and falls into place it's gonna wake you up. The corrections officers all go sit in their office when they are done doing whatever. We call it a bubble, it has windows they can see out of but it dampens any sound. Plus they are watching TV or listening to music, chatting, eating. They don't care about some yelling or rapping. Door kicking is a big one too, can't believe I forgot that. If they wanted to they could try to get someone to stop, say they will get a ticket if they keep being disruptive, but inmates don't give a fuck generally. Also by extending their time in the hole it just extends the time said officers have to deal with the problem inmates, they aren't always looking to do that
